      I just install Pfsense on a CF Card that is running Pfsense on old firebox x router I got it online but under interface tab there is only WAN IP address no LAN how do I re-added  ?

          You should be able to go to "Interfaces->assign" then on Interface Assignments click on the "+" at the bottom of the window to add in a new interface.  You can choose which hardware NIC you attach to the interface from the drop down box (little black arrow).

          Was this working originally and you managed to remove the LAN assignment or did it not install at all?

              When you add the LAN interface you will lose access to the webgui via the WAN. Make sure you've added enough settings to the LAN to allow you to connect to it or add a firewall rule to WAN to allow continued access.
